    the problem with the licensing model is, the R+ library is about 8x the size of my CustomsForge library. I only have maybe 50 songs out of that CF library on regular rotation. The R+ library is missing almost all of them. The 8000 tracks sounds impressive, but Songsterr has 800k and GuitarPro has over a million.
    We know Rocksmith songs are just GP5 tabs plus the audio zipped into a single file. The tabs aren't copyright infringement, so really what we need is a streaming-service type deal with the major labels.

      Sometimes people are not used to reading tabs or can't process the visual information quickly enough. My dad who grew up learning everything by ear with no visual input has trouble with it.
      The biggest mistake experienced musicians make IMO is setting the difficulty too high when they aren't used to the interface yet and don't know the songs. RS is about precision and is great for practicing timing. The dynamic difficulty level will add more note information as needed, it's great.

    I played a bit of Rocksmith 2014 in the past, and I never understood the way they try to teach songs. I really don't see the value in teaching 'easier' versions of riffs, where basically just some notes are left out. Every note added back in basically requires the player to re-learn the riff entirely. There's not much point in developing muscle memory for a dumbed-down version of a riff you want to play.
    The way I usually learn by tabs is by playing the notes slowly to get used to the fingerings and remember what to play. Then I try to play in somewhat correct rhythm and tempo, until I get to the point where I can actually play to the song. The riff repeater in Rocksmith is a great tool for this approach, but only if I have the tabs available to me at the same time
    I also think the stream of notes is a lot harder to read than traditional tabs, but maybe that's only a matter of getting used to it.
